Overview
The FOXBORO 0303393 is a high-performance OptoNet Node Board engineered for Foxboro’s PAC and I/A Series DCS platforms. It enables fast, reliable communication between controllers and field devices, ensuring precise data acquisition and real-time process control.
With support for analog, logic, and sequential control, the 0303393 integrates seamlessly with Wonderware® and InFusion™ ECS software. Its rugged design and redundant power capability make it ideal for demanding automation environments, including oil & gas, power generation, chemical, and pharmaceutical industries.
Technical Specifications
Parameter | Details |
---|---|
Model | 0303393 |
Manufacturer | Foxboro |
Type | OptoNet Node Board |
System Compatibility | Foxboro PAC System, I/A Series DCS |
Function | High-speed communication and control node |
Control Capabilities | Continuous analog, logic, sequential |
Data Recording | Secure point-of-measurement recording |
Communication Protocols | HDLC Fieldbus, Modbus, Ethernet |
Software Integration | Wonderware®, InFusion™ ECS |
Power Supply | 24 V DC (redundant input supported) |
Mounting Type | Modular baseplate or DIN rail |
Operating Temperature | –20°C to +70°C (–4°F to +158°F) |
Humidity Range | 5% to 95% RH (non-condensing) |
Certifications | CE, UL, RoHS, IEC 61131-2 |
